Albert 'Al' Gillis Laney (January 11, 1896 – January 31, 1988) was an American sportswriter who specialized in tennis and golf but also covered baseball, boxing and American football.Laney was born on January 11, 1896 in Pensacola, Florida, the son of an attorney and one of six children. He served as a lieutenant in World War I and saw action at The Battle of the Argonne Forest.After World War I Laney became a correspondent at the New York Evening Mail.
